Job Summary

Construction Manager for federal projects oversees day-to-day field operations, ensuring adherence to contract documents, drawings and specifications; leads construction administration, safety, QA/QC, and schedule adherence for projects over $100M. Requires experience with design-build/design-bid-build, federal/institutional delivery, and knowledge of government standards; SOX may apply. Based in Tucson, AZ with on-site requirements.
Location: Tucson
Workplace: Onsite
Employment Type: Full time
Job Function: Construction, Civil & Site Engineering
Seniority: Mid level

Key Responsibilities

  • •Oversee daily contractor field operations and ensure adherence to approved plans/specifications.
  • •Monitor site safety, security, and environmental compliance.
  • •Support review of RFIs, submittals, shop drawings, and change orders.
  • •Coordinate commissioning and turnover processes.
  • •Prepare and maintain field reports, schedules, and documentation.

Key Requirements

  • •Bachelor’s degree in Construction Management, Engineering, or related field preferred.
  • •15+ years of construction management experience with at least one project over $100M.
  • •Strong experience in federal or institutional project delivery.
  • •Familiarity with design-build and design-bid-build methods.
  • •Knowledge of Government standards and procedures preferred.
